What sets an innovative leader apart from the rest? Discover the key traits and strategies that define truly creative leadership in our latest episode. Drawing from the insights of influential figures like Oprah, Tyler Perry, Thomas Edison, and Steve Jobs, we explore how significance, persistence, and the willingness to innovate can transform your leadership approach. Whether it's Oprah's focus on significance or Edison's numerous failures, these leaders offer invaluable lessons on pushing boundaries and fostering creativity within teams.
Join Greg and me as we unravel the mechanics of innovative leadership by sharing real-world examples and techniques straight from the trenches. From creative brainstorming sessions at a consumer package goods company to a memorable analogy about a band leader producing unique sounds by switching instruments, we highlight the importance of adaptability and out-of-the-box thinking.
